SyFy (which made a lot more sense when it was called ‘Sci-Fi’) feels like a network run by schizophrenics.  On one hand you have Asylum features like “Sharknado” and “Atlantic Rim,” movies with bad acting, schlocky premises and very unspecial special effects.  On the other you have series like the remarkable reboot of “Battlestar Galactica.”

A new SyFy series, “Helix” appears to be firmly on the quality side of things.  It’s from Ronald Moore, who also worked on ‘Battlestar’ and revolves around a team at the CDC (Centers for Disease Control and Prevention) who deal with infectious diseases.

“Helix” premieres today, 10/9c.  Here are fifteen minutes from the premiere.
